> I'm having problems with using smbclient on a win2k share. The server runs samba 3.0.14a on Solaris 9.
> 
> I want to tar the whole directory of a share. Into a file on the server
> 
> What I found out so far is, that it works until a maximum file count of 35. It is not size dependant but if the file count in that share exceeds more than 35 the smbclient hangs for ever and with the time is consuming up all the available memory. Until the server hangs as well due to a lack of memory space. 
> 
> Any ideas would be greatly appreciated.

This is probably the "infinate spin" reading directories
bug which we've fixed in SVN. Try this patch for 3.0.14a.

Jeremy


Hi Jeremy,

thank you, that patch fixed the problem.
